LATEST NEWS FROM AS ROMA – Fabio Pecchia, coach of Parma, comments after the match on the performance of his boys in the league match that was just played at the Stadio Tardini against Roma. Here are the statements of the ducal coach to the microphones of journalists at the end of the match:
What does Parma lack?
“We are the youngest team but that is not an alibi. We are alive even if the numbers are hard to analyze. The team is alive and has the will to live.”
What is the locker room like?
“I have a very deep relationship with the boys; I’ve seen them grow. Even this hard time serves for their future. They need to accelerate this formative path because we need to score points. I don’t talk about episodes and bad luck because it’s part of soccer, but I see this team alive.”
It is right to move forward on this path….
“We got Djuric but we lost him for the whole league, he was an important alternative player. I have to speed up the insertion of newcomers. We want to play this way, it is our philosophy. In the second half I saw a team that was aware of what it had to do.”
Better penalty with yellow or penalty with red?
“That is not bad luck. Kudos to Soulé, he made a great play. You don’t see so many goals like that in Serie A. Right now the episodes are turning us wrong, but I remain confident because I see the boys working.”
